The National Revenue Authority (NRA) tax education team, led by the Commissioner General, Jeneba J. Bangura, today joined the Ministry of Information and Civic Education (MoICE) in Moyamba to provide tax education to hundreds of stakeholders, taxpayers, and community beneficiaries, including traditional leaders, market women and traders, students, and workers, as part of MoICE's Provincial Civic Day Series.
The NRA focused its engagement on the theme “Relevance of paying Taxes on National Development".
The gathering provided a valuable opportunity for the NRA to engage directly with taxpayers and emphasize the significance of tax compliance and civic responsibility. During the event, the Commissioner -General delivered an impactful address, underscoring the vital role of taxes in national development and the advantages of having an informed taxpayer base “It is a civic responsibility to pay taxes, and when we pay taxes, the government uses the money to bring development to our communities,” Commissioner General Bangura highlighted.
The day featured interactive discussions and informational booths designed to educate participants about their tax obligations and the recent reforms implemented by the NRA.
